Dating Confidence Reset

Start by clarifying what you want and why. List two or three non-negotiables (values, dealbreakers, or priorities) and one flexible preference. When your goals are clear—whether you want casual conversation, a serious relationship, or simply to meet new people—you can judge matches against those priorities instead of reacting to every message.

Pace conversations intentionally. Aim for steady progress: a few thoughtful messages over several days, then a short call or video chat before meeting. Rushing or waiting too long both create friction; decide a comfortable timeline for yourself and stick to it so you feel less at the mercy of other people’s schedules.

Keep expectations realistic. Online dating is a filtering process, not a reflection of your worth. Treat each interaction as information gathering: some leads will fizzle, others will develop. Avoid equating response speed or match volume with personal value—progress can be slow and still be meaningful.

Notice small wins and track progress. Celebrate clarity: a good conversation, a clear boundary set, or recognizing a pattern that narrows your search. These are signs you’re learning and improving, even if they don’t immediately lead to a relationship.

Prioritize emotional steadiness and self-respect. Keep early conversations light and polite, and step away from threads that drain you. If someone disrespects your time or boundaries, end the exchange without prolonged explanations. Protecting your energy helps you stay confident and available for better matches.

Choose matches thoughtfully. Look beyond surface filters—read profiles for shared values or interests, note how people describe themselves, and prefer matches who communicate clearly about intent. A focused short list of quality prospects beats endless swiping or messaging.

Practical tip: Set small, measurable goals each week—send three new messages, ask for one phone call, or refine your profile—and review what worked. Small, steady steps rebuild confidence faster than trying to control every outcome.
